CNNE Stock Analysis - Frequently Asked Questions

Cannae's stock was trading at $15.71 at the start of the year. Since then, CNNE shares have decreased by 14.0% and is now trading at $13.5110.

Cannae Holdings, Inc. (NYSE:CNNE) posted its quarterly earnings data on Monday, May, 11th. The company reported ($0.70)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.40) by $0.30. The company's revenue was down 6.8% on a year-over-year basis.

Cannae's Board of Directors approved a share repurchase program on Tuesday, March 25th 2025, which allows the company to buy back 10,000,000 shares, according to EventVestor. This allows the company to reacquire shares of its stock through open market purchases. Shares buyback programs are typically a sign that the company's leadership believes its shares are undervalued.

Top institutional investors of Cannae include Poehling Capital Management INC. (2.06%), Bulldog Investors LLP (0.68%), Bank of America Corp DE (0.57%) and Gabelli Funds LLC (0.44%). Insiders that own company stock include Peter T Sadowski and Frank R Martire.
